What is a class b license?
There are lots of various types of business driver's licenses, and the type you require depends on the kind of automobile you desire to drive. For instance, if you desire to drive big-rig trucks, you will require a class A CDL. However if you only need to drive little buses or dispose trucks, then you will need a class B CDL. The main difference in between classes is the quantity of weight they can haul, and this varies from one state to another.
If you require to carry more than 26,000 pounds of cargo, you will need a class A CDL. This is the most popular option for truck drivers, as it allows them to drive a range of various type of cars. This includes straight trucks, tractor-trailer combinations, flatbeds, and more. In addition, class A motorists can likewise get recommendations that enable them to drive more customized vehicles or carry specific types of freight.
A class B CDL is more restricting in terms of what kinds of vehicles it can operate, but it is still an exceptional choice for those who desire to work in the trucking industry. With this license, you can operate a single automobile that has a gross lorry weight rating of 26,001 or more pounds, as well as any trailer that weighs less than 10,000 pounds.
This type of CDL likewise allows you to operate smaller sized passenger vans and buses, and it can be coupled with the proper HazMat or Passenger Endorsement. It is an excellent option for those who need to transfer travelers or materials that need special placarding.
The certifications for getting a class B license differ by state, however in the majority of cases, you will require a non-commercial driver's license, a high school diploma, and a tidy driving record. In some states, you can even receive a class B license at age 18, though you will not be able to take a trip throughout state lines till you turn 21.

How do I get a class b license?
Getting your class B license is one of the first steps in ending up being a business driver. It permits you to drive single freight cars, such as dump trucks that weigh more than 26,000 pounds or trailers that can carry less than 10,000 pounds. You can likewise get endorsements to allow you to operate other types of trucks, like those that transport harmful materials or guest buses.

To get approved for a class B license, you need to have a high school diploma or GED certificate, a tidy driving record, and pass a medical examination that assesses your hearing, vision, high blood pressure, and heart function. The specific requirements differ by state, so you should consult your regional DMV to learn more about the procedure.
In New York City, you can become a bus driver with a class B P/S license, which certifies you to drive MTA yellow school buses and transit buses for NYC Transit. Where can I get a class b license?
In the United States, a class B driver's license is part of the CDL (industrial drivers' license) category that allows you to drive single cars that weigh more than 26,000 pounds or have a trailer that weighs less than 10,000 pounds. This includes straight trucks, discard truck, busses, and box trucks. You can likewise make CDL endorsements (additional authorizations) that let you run cars like hazmat.
The certifications for a class B driver's license vary by state, but typically consist of a high school diploma or GED certificate, a tidy driving record, and your state's age requirements. Some states permit you to get a class B license at 18, but you won't have the ability to take a trip out of state in that lorry until you turn 21.
Class B CDL holders can discover work with shipment companies like UPS, FedEx, and Amazon, as well as bus driving jobs like city buses and Greyhounds. You can also work as a construction and energy crew trucker, or for regional government agencies that need to move equipment or products around the city. Lots of people begin their trucking careers with a class B license and upgrade to a Class A license as they get experience on the roadway.
